[Bug 163626] Re: Root needs more shortcuts/places

2008-05-28 Thread A. Walton
Neither of these statements are related to Nautilus. In both described situations, the Gtk+ FileChooser(Dialog) is what takes care of these actions. However, I'm not sure that the fix is at all an easy one; rather, applications should get PolicyKit support to escalate their privileges as needed
